Steps
- Horseradish-Crusted Salmon with Crispy Leeks: Coat sliced leeks with cornstarch and pan-fry until crispy. Spread horseradish-infused mayonnaise over salmon fillets and bake for a moist and flavorful dish.
- Cheesy Portobello Chicken Cutlets with Broccoli: Sauté chicken cutlets and top them with nutty Gruyère cheese. Finish under the broiler for a deliciously cheesy crust.
- Easy Shrimp Scampi with Zucchini Noodles: Sauté shrimp in a white wine butter sauce, adding tomatoes for sweetness. Serve over zucchini noodles for a lightened-up classic dish.
- Chicken Cutlets with Roasted Red Pepper & Arugula Relish: Cook chicken cutlets and top with a relish made of roasted red peppers, arugula, and currants for added sweetness.
- One-Pot Garlicky Shrimp & Broccoli: Sauté shrimp and broccoli in one pot for a quick meal. Serve over whole grains or rice for a complete dinner.
- Chopped Power Salad with Chicken: Toss together a vibrant salad with chicken, making the dressing directly in the bowl to coat the greens with flavor.
- Chicken Salad: Combine Greek yogurt and mayonnaise for a creamy dressing, and mix with chicken, apple, hazelnuts, and celery. Serve over lightly dressed greens.
- 20-Minute Creamy Tomato Salmon Skillet: Cook salmon fillets in a creamy sauce with tomatoes and zucchini. This quick dish is flavored with Italian seasoning and ready in 20 minutes.
- Pesto Salmon: Coat salmon fillets with herby pesto and bake with cherry tomatoes and shallots for a quick, flavorful dinner.
- Arugula, Chicken & Melon Salad with Sumac Dressing: Combine ripe melon and chicken in a salad with a lemony sumac dressing. Use leftover melon for a refreshing smoothie.
- Crispy Salmon Cakes with Creamy Cucumber Salad: Form canned salmon into patties seasoned with Old Bay, pan-sear, and serve with a cucumber and red onion salad.
- Broiled Cauliflower ‘Mac’ & Cheese: Use cauliflower instead of pasta in a creamy cheese dish. Top with Parmesan and broil for a crispy finish.
- Lemon-Garlic Steak & Green Beans: Sear strip steak and cook green beans in the same pan, enhancing their flavor with steak drippings.
- Blackened Chicken with Chopped Salad: Grill spiced chicken and serve with a chopped salad for a fresh twist on a classic dish.
- Cheesy Ground Beef & Cauliflower Casserole: Combine ground beef and cauliflower in a cheesy casserole. Serve with tortilla chips and sour cream.
- Caesar Salad with Grilled Steak: Replace egg yolk with mayo for a creamy Caesar dressing, and top with grilled steak slices.
- Sheet-Pan Balsamic Chicken & Asparagus: Roast chicken cutlets and asparagus on a sheet pan with a balsamic glaze for an easy one-pan meal.
- Tofu & Watercress Salad with Mango & Avocado: Toss tofu, mango, and avocado with watercress for a fresh plant-based salad.
- Ginger Beef Stir-Fry with Peppers: Stir-fry beef with peppers and a chile-garlic sauce. Serve with cauliflower rice if desired.
- Shrimp Cauliflower Fried Rice: Create a low-carb fried rice using cauliflower and shrimp for a healthy dinner option.
- Spinach & Artichoke Chicken: Top chicken cutlets with a creamy cheese mixture inspired by artichoke dip for a savory meal.
- Spicy Coconut, Chicken & Mushroom Soup: Combine coconut milk with chicken and mushrooms in a spicy Thai-inspired soup.
- 15-Minute Sheet-Pan Chicken Tenders & Broccoli: Broil chicken tenders with everything bagel seasoning and serve with broccoli and a sweet-spicy dipping sauce.
- Salmon & Avocado Salad: Toss salmon with a salad of red cabbage, carrots, and avocados, dressed in a creamy dill vinaigrette.
- Scallops & Cherry Tomatoes with Caper-Butter Sauce: Sear scallops and serve with a caper-butter sauce, adding zucchini noodles or mashed cauliflower for the sauce.
- Cauliflower Rice Bowls with Grilled Chicken: Top Greek-inspired cauliflower rice with feta, olives, veggies, and grilled chicken for a quick meal.
- Skillet Buffalo Chicken: Sauté chicken cutlets and cover with a creamy Buffalo sauce. Serve with a salad garnish of carrots, celery, and blue cheese.
- Crispy Cod with Charred Snow Peas & Creamy Herb Sauce: Dredge cod in flour and sauté for a golden crust. Serve with charred snow peas and a creamy herb sauce.
- 20-Minute Chicken Cutlets & Zucchini Noodles with Creamy Tomato Sauce: Cook chicken cutlets and zucchini noodles in a creamy tomato sauce for a quick low-carb meal.
- Vegan Burrito Bowls with Cauliflower Rice: Prepare vegan burrito bowls using frozen cauliflower rice and a variety of toppings for a nutritious, easy meal.

Tips
- Substitute Cheese Options: When making Cheesy Portobello Chicken Cutlets, if Gruyère is unavailable, consider using Jarlsberg or Emmentaler cheese as they both offer a similar nutty flavor profile.
- Quick Cooking Techniques: For the Lemon-Garlic Steak & Green Beans, choose a New York strip for a balance of tenderness and reduced fat content compared to other cuts. Cooking the green beans in the same pan as the steak will enhance their flavor and reduce cleanup time.
- Spiralizing Tip: In the Easy Shrimp Scampi with Zucchini Noodles, if you have a spiralizer, consider making your own zucchini noodles using two medium zucchinis for the freshest taste.
- Crispy Fish Without Deep Frying: When preparing Crispy Cod with Charred Snow Peas, achieve a golden crust by patting the fish dry and lightly dredging it in flour before sautéing, eliminating the need for deep frying.
